Output 66b4043ef2589eaf216d33375af6623dd842d7fff3acd85a48a508206ce9e7ce:0
- value
- 1567923
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 babdb7e642ebc159b6a325a6559bfd21d9052906dce8197ccd06005098d2ff8f
- address
- bc1ph27m0ejza0q4nd4rykn9txlay8vs22gxmn5pjlxdqcq9pxxjl78snck9pl
- transaction
- 66b4043ef2589eaf216d33375af6623dd842d7fff3acd85a48a508206ce9e7ce